Current ROM code barely contains some valid SH-2 opcodes but not enough for a HD64F7045F28. i.e. It doesn't contain VBR set-up, valid irq routines,
|
||||
a valid irq table and no internal SH-2 i/o set-up. sub-routine at 0xe0 also points to 0x4b0, which is full of illegal opcodes with current ROM.
|
||||
Two possible reasons about this:
|
||||
* U11 isn't really empty or ...
|
||||
* There's an internal ROM (pages 43 and 78 of the HD64F7045F28 manual hints that). And really, good luck into finding a way for trojanning that
|
||||
(exotic usage of the SCIF seems the only possible route)
|
||||
|
||||
The HD64F7045F28 manual says that there's an on-chip ROM at 0-0x3ffff (page 168), meaning that this one definitely needs a trojan/decap (and also an SH-2 core
|
||||
that supports the very different i/o map ;-)
